Today, we invite you to join us as we shine a light on El Rayo, a delightful Mexican eatery nestled in the heart of Scarborough, Maine.

A Haven for Mexican Flavor in Maine: Their OG location in in Portland. The Scarborough location is conveniently located right on Route One. Savoring Mexi-Centric Delights: Our taste buds embarked on a voyage of discovery as we sampled an array of Mexican-inspired creations:

Carne Asada Taco: The savory steak and grilled poblano strips in the carne asada taco danced on our palates, evoking the vibrant flavors of Mexico.

“Americano Taco“: Despite its crunchy shell, the “Americano Taco” delighted us with its smoky chipotle-infused ground beef, a testament to El Rayo’s culinary artistry.

Rice and Beans: Simple yet satisfying, the rice and beans showcased the restaurant’s commitment to quality ingredients and authentic flavors.

Chips and Salsa: Homemade chips and salsa captivated our senses with their fresh, smoky flavors—a testament to El Rayo’s dedication to homemade goodness.

Elote: While the elote may not have reached the heights of its street-side counterparts, it provided a glimpse into the soul of Mexican street food—a commendable effort by El Rayo.

Sipping on Spicy Margaritas: The spicy margarita, with its fresh jalapenos and hint of cilantro, stole the show, leaving us yearning for another round of Mexi-Centric refreshment.
